2009 Maybach 57 vs. 1986 Nissan Cedric

To start off, 2009 Maybach 57 is newer by 23 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 Nissan Cedric.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 Nissan Cedric would be higher. At 5,979 cc (12 cylinders), 2009 Maybach 57 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Maybach 57 (604 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 502 more horse power than 1986 Nissan Cedric. (102 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Maybach 57 should accelerate faster than 1986 Nissan Cedric.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Maybach 57 weights approximately 1460 kg more than 1986 Nissan Cedric.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Maybach 57 (1,001 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 834 more torque (in Nm) than 1986 Nissan Cedric. (167 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 2009 Maybach 57 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1986 Nissan Cedric. 2009 Maybach 57 has automatic transmission and 1986 Nissan Cedric has manual transmission. 1986 Nissan Cedric will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Maybach 57 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

2009 Maybach 57 1986 Nissan Cedric
Make Maybach Nissan
Model 57 Cedric
Year Released 2009 1986
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5979 cc 1973 cc
Engine Cylinders 12 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 604 HP 102 HP
Engine RPM 4800 RPM 5600 RPM
Torque 1001 Nm 167 Nm
Torque RPM 2000 RPM 3600 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Vehicle Weight 2735 kg 1275 kg
Vehicle Length 5730 mm 4790 mm
Vehicle Width 1990 mm 1710 mm
Vehicle Height 1560 mm 1440 mm
Wheelbase Size 3400 mm 2740 mm
